$o

This variable is replaced with the current

month in number with leading zero, possible

values: 01, 02, …, 12

$O

-

$p

-

$P

This variable is replaced with the current

AM/PM status in upper case, possible values:

AM, PM

$r

This variable is replaced with the volume level $R

-

$s

This variable is replaced with the current

second of minute with leading zero, possible

values: 01, 02, …, 59

$S

This variable is replaced with the state name

of the weather information

$t

-

$T

This variable is replaced with the current

hour:minute (am/pm) of the day, in which ":"

will flash per second. Depending on user's

configuration, it will be displayed as 12 hour or

24 hour format. Possible values: 1:00pm,

13:00

$v

This variable is replaced with 5V power usage

alert message when incorrect power is used

$V

This variable is replaced with the configured

Account SIP Server host

$w

This variable is replaced with the temperature

of the weather information

$W

This variable is replaced with the current day

of week and has the following possible

values:

Sunday, Monday, Tuesday,

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, Saturday

$x

This variable is replaced with the humidity of

the weather information

$X

This variable is replaced with the configured

Account SIP User ID

$y

This variable is replaced with the current year

in 2-digit number, for example: 06, 07

$Y

This variable is replaced with the current year

in 4-digit number, for example: 2006, 2007 …

$xU

This variable is replaced with account x's configured SIP User ID where x is 0 to 5 for account 1 to

account 6. For example, $0U is account 1's SIP User ID if configured.

$xN

This variable is replaced with account x' s Display Name if filled in, otherwise account x' s Account

Name will be used where x is 0 to 5 for account 1 to account 6. For example, $0N is account 1's

Display Name if configured. If account 1's Display Name is not configured, $0N will be replaced with

account 1's Account Name.

$xS

This variable is replaced with account x' s SIP Server where x is 0 to 5 for account 1 to account 6.

For example, $0S is account 1's SIP Server if configured.

Note:

To display "$", please use "$$" escape sequence.
